China Factory Output Accelerates as Export Orders Recover
Beijing— China’s factory activity expanded at a faster pace in April as export orders improved and domestic industrial output strengthened despite continued concerns over global trade volatility and geopolitical risks, official data showed on Monday.
Industrial firms reported stronger profit growth, supported by recovering manufacturing demand and targeted government stimulus measures aimed at stabilizing employment and consumption.
Analysts said sustained recovery would depend on external demand and confidence in the property sector, which continues to weigh on broader economic momentum.
